Dubbo mayor Ben Shields says a Facebook post with his name on it saying the taxpayers are the traditional owners of the land was created by a fake profile.

The post says "Today on Facebook, I'd like to acknowledge the traditional owners of this land - the taxpayer."
It goes on to say "For over 200 years [they have] been persecuted and as a people they have been through a huge ordeal, yet they continue to survive rich in heritage and perseverance.".

The screenshot shows the post from December 20, 2010 has come from a Ben Shields page, using a photo of the mayor and his dog.
But while the mayor did not wish to comment on the post, he denied publishing it. Cr Shields said it was a fake account designed to look like his.
